Calcium is the primary mineral found in milk products. It is essential for maintaining strong bones and teeth, as well as supporting various bodily functions, including muscle contraction and nerve signaling. In addition to calcium, milk products also contain other important minerals like phosphorus and potassium.

Milk itself is not classified as a mineral; rather, it is a nutrient-rich liquid produced by mammals that contains a variety of essential nutrients, including minerals. Key minerals found in milk include calcium, phosphorus, potassium, and magnesium, which are important for various bodily functions. These minerals contribute to bone health, muscle function, and overall metabolic processes. Thus, while milk contains minerals, it is not a mineral in itself.
